FV Pacific 1; Unalaska Island, Alaska. Unalaska Island, Alaska. 1. On 15-FEB-2019, at 0430, the FV Pacific I was reported sunk approximately 3 miles northwest of Kismaliuk Bay on the northwest side of Unalaska Island. It is unknown if there has been any release; estimated total of oils on board is 6000 gallons. Vessel is sunk in approximately 225 feet of water. USCG Sector Anchorage is requesting fate and trajectory at this time. 2. THREAT: OIL. COMMODITY: DIESEL. MAXIMUM POTENTIAL RELEASE: 6000 GALLONS. 3. POSITION 53.510N 167.187W.
